The world of mobile gaming has exploded in popularity over the years, with millions of users around the globe enjoying games on their smartphones and tablets. If you have a great game idea and want to bring it to life, creating a game app can be an exciting and rewarding endeavor. In this blog post, we will guide you through the step-by-step process of creating your very own game app.
1. Define Your Game Concept
The first and most crucial step is to define your game concept. Consider the genre, gameplay mechanics, characters, and storyline of your game. A unique and engaging concept will help your game stand out in the competitive market.
2. Plan and Design
Once you have a clear game concept, it’s time to plan and design your game. Create a detailed game design document that outlines the core features, levels, user interface, and monetization strategy. This document will serve as a roadmap for your development process.
3. Choose the Right Development Tools
Selecting the right development tools is essential for a smooth game development experience. Depending on your skills and preferences, you can choose from various game development platforms and engines such as Unity, Unreal Engine, or Godot. These tools provide a range of features and resources to facilitate game development.
4. Develop the Game Mechanics
Next, start building the game mechanics based on your design document. This involves programming the gameplay elements, including controls, physics, artificial intelligence, and any unique features specific to your game. Iterate and test your mechanics to ensure they are fun and engaging.
5. Create Artwork and Assets
Visuals play a vital role in game app development. Create or hire a team of artists to design and create the artwork and assets for your game. This includes character designs, environments, objects, animations, and user interface elements. Consistent and visually appealing artwork enhances the overall player experience.
6. Integrate Sound and Music
Sound effects and music can significantly enhance the immersion and atmosphere of your game. Consider hiring a sound designer or composer to create original audio content for your game. Integrate these elements into your game app to provide a captivating audio experience.
7. Test and Refine
Testing is a crucial phase of game development. Identify and fix any bugs, glitches, or performance issues in your game. Conduct playtests with a group of beta testers to gather feedback and make necessary improvements. Iterate and refine your game based on user feedback to ensure a polished final product.
8. Publish and Market Your Game
Once your game is ready, it’s time to publish it on relevant app stores such as the Apple App Store or Google Play Store. Follow the respective guidelines and requirements for app submission. Additionally, create a marketing strategy to generate awareness and reach your target audience. Utilize social media, influencers, and online advertising to promote your game.
9. Gather and Analyze User Feedback
After launching your game, actively collect user feedback and reviews. Listen to your players’ suggestions and implement updates to improve their gaming experience. Regularly update your game with new content, features, and bug fixes to keep your audience engaged.
10. Monetization Strategies
Finally, consider various monetization strategies for your game. This can include in-app purchases, ads, subscriptions, or a combination of these models. Choose a strategy that aligns with your game and target audience while ensuring a fair and enjoyable experience for your players.
Creating a game app is a complex but highly rewarding process. With careful planning, thoughtful design, and diligent development, you can bring your game idea to life and captivate players worldwide. Embrace the journey, learn from challenges, and never stop exploring new possibilities to create memorable gaming experiences.
Ready to create your own game app? Define your game concept, plan and design, choose the right development tools, develop game mechanics, create stunning artwork and assets, integrate sound and music, test and refine, publish and market, gather user feedback, and implement monetization strategies. Embrace the journey, learn from challenges, and never stop exploring new possibilities to create memorable gaming experiences. Start building your dream game app today!
Shubham is a professional marketer, startup enthusiast, and LinkedIn addict. He is helping IT agencies to grow 10 times by promoting the brands and companies. He would love to meet founders in tech services fields.